Job Description

Tribes is a Rs. 800 crore companyin capitalized billingand largest customerexperience
organizationin the country of fully integrated marketing agencies. We have been investing in technology that enables customer experience across OOH, Events, Activation and Retailand have developed solutions and ...

Apply for this Position

Ready to join Tribes Communication? Click the button below to submit your application.

Submit Application